Types of schools and students on Cebu Island

Cebu Island is home to a diverse array of schools, ranging from public institutions to private academies. In underprivileged areas, many students attend public schools with limited resources and overcrowded classrooms. Despite the challenges they face, these students are eager to learn and excel in their studies.

In more affluent areas, there are private schools that offer a higher standard of education and extracurricular opportunities for their students. These schools cater to a mix of local children and expatriate families seeking quality education.

Students on Cebu Island come from various backgrounds, including urban centers like Cebu City and rural villages across the island. They bring with them unique perspectives and experiences that enrich the learning environment in their respective schools.

How to find volunteer opportunities in Cebu Island

Are you eager to make a difference through volunteer teaching in Cebu Island? Finding opportunities is easier than you might think! Start by reaching out to local schools, community centers, or organizations dedicated to education. Many of them welcome volunteers with open arms and can connect you with schools in need.

Another way to find volunteer teaching opportunities is through online platforms and websites specializing in volunteering abroad. These platforms often list various projects available on Cebu Island, allowing you to choose based on your interests and availability.

Networking can also be a valuable tool. Talk to other volunteers who have worked in Cebu Island or join social media groups related to volunteering. They may have recommendations or insights on where you can contribute effectively.

Tips for a successful experience

Embarking on a volunteer teaching experience in Cebu Island can be incredibly rewarding, but it’s essential to be well-prepared for this journey. Here are some tips for ensuring a successful and fulfilling experience:

Familiarize yourself with the local culture and customs of Cebu City. Understanding the background of the community you’ll be working with can help you connect better with your students.

Flexibility is key when volunteering in underprivileged areas. Be prepared for unexpected challenges or changes in plans and approach them with an open mind.

Effective communication is crucial when teaching in Cebu Island schools. Take the time to learn basic phrases in the local language to facilitate interaction with students and fellow teachers.

Building relationships with students, colleagues, and community members can enhance your impact as a volunteer teacher. Show respect, empathy, and patience towards everyone you encounter during your time in Cebu Island.
